Ferrari part ways with reserve driver Zhou Guanyu after one season
The world of Formula 1 has witnessed a significant development as Ferrari has officially announced its decision to part ways with reserve driver Zhou Guanyu. This move comes ahead of the highly anticipated 2026 Formula 1 season, leaving Guanyu without a race seat for the upcoming year. The news has sent shockwaves throughout the F1 community, with fans and pundits alike speculating about the reasons behind this sudden decision.
Zhou Guanyu’s association with Ferrari dates back to 2014 when he joined the prestigious Ferrari Driver Academy. During his tenure at the academy, which lasted until 2018, Guanyu demonstrated immense potential and skill, earning him a reputation as a talented young driver. In 2025, he was appointed as a reserve driver for Ferrari, sharing the role with Antonio Giovinazzi. This position not only provided Guanyu with valuable experience but also gave him a glimpse into the inner workings of one of the most successful teams in F1 history.
Despite his impressive background and the experience gained as a reserve driver, Ferrari has chosen not to continue its association with Zhou Guanyu. The team’s decision has left Guanyu without a clear path forward, at least for the 2026 season.
